Landslide Forces Evacuation of Twelve Homes in Rolling Hills Estates

A massive landslide has occurred, leading to the evacuation of 12 homes on Peartree Lane near a canyon in Rolling Hills Estates.

At approximately 4 p.m. on Saturday, residents and authorities in the area noticed the land shifting, prompting the immediate evacuation of the residents.

Janice Hahn, Los Angeles County Supervisor, took to Twitter to confirm the evacuations, stating, “I’m in Rolling Hills Estates where multiple homes are threatened by a major landslide.”

Hahn mentioned that the Los Angeles County Fire Department issued the evacuation orders.

Deputies from the Lomita station of the sheriff’s department were dispatched to patrol the neighborhood and ensure the safety of the evacuated homes, according to Hahn.

In her tweets, Hahn shared several photos illustrating the precarious state of the homes.

She tweeted, “In this photo, it’s difficult to see, but there are homes in Rolling Hills Estates that are physically leaning, like this garage after the landslide. I had the chance to speak with the evacuated residents. Everyone is safe, but the homes are currently too unstable to enter. I have already communicated with Mark Pastrella, our Public Works Director, and we are extending full support to the city and our residents.”

The local electricity supply has been disconnected, and utility crews have ensured the integrity of gas and power lines, as per the authorities.

The American Red Cross is assisting the evacuated families in finding suitable shelter.

The cause of the landslide remains unknown at this time.
